How much money will you need for your trip to Greece? You should plan to spend around €123 ($144) per day on your vacation in Greece, which is the average daily price based on the expenses of other visitors. Past travelers have spent, on average, €32 ($37) on meals for one day and €24 ($28) on local transportation.

How much does it cost to backpack in Greece?

Backpacking Greece Suggested Budgets Greece is a very budget friendly destination. If you’re backpacking Greece, my suggested budget is 40-60 EUR / 45-65 USD per day. This is assuming you’re staying in a hostel, eating cheap food, cooking some of your meals, not taking a lot of tours and using local transportation.
